Description
Kurumi Imari is the main character's childhood friend and neighbor, attending the same academy and serving as president of the school's art club. She maintains a daily routine of waking him each morning, demonstrating concern through their interactions, including preparing meals despite a limited cooking repertoire focused primarily on curry dishes. Her feelings for him extend beyond friendship, though initially unreciprocated.

Trained in Shorinji Kempo and holding a black belt, she possesses significant martial prowess used defensively. Her life becomes entangled in supernatural conflicts after encountering a dark magic artifact. Her status as one of the school's few virgins designates her as the ideal sacrifice for a ritual orchestrated by the primary antagonist seeking a vessel for reincarnation, leading to her capture and physical assault intended to break her spirit before the ceremony.

During the climactic confrontation, the antagonist successfully transfers her consciousness into Kurumi's body through occult means. However, this possession proves incomplete; Kurumi's soul persists alongside the invading presence rather than being fully displaced, creating an unresolved spiritual conflict.

Years later, she resurfaces as a psychic investigator leading murder cases, having matured physically with more pronounced feminine features. This professional path connects directly to her traumatic past, as the investigations inadvertently reawaken the dormant antagonist consciousness within her, triggering internal battles for control during inquiries. Her work receives guidance from a former instructor now operating within religious circles. The lingering antagonist presence within her psyche continues to influence events, driving central conflicts throughout her adult investigations despite her efforts to maintain autonomy.
